Rebuilding Syria's Economy After Dictatorship with Internet of Things Technology

In the aftermath of a long and devastating dictatorship, rebuilding Syria's economy is a monumental task that requires innovative solutions and forward-thinking approaches. One such approach that holds great promise is the integration of Internet of Things (IoT) technology into various sectors of the economy. The Internet of Things refers to the network of interconnected devices and sensors that collect and exchange data over the internet. This technology has the potential to revolutionize industries by enabling real-time monitoring, analysis, and automation of processes. In the context of rebuilding Syria's economy, IoT can play a crucial role in driving efficiency, increasing productivity, and promoting sustainable development. One area where IoT can make a significant impact is in the infrastructure sector. With much of Syria's infrastructure in ruins after years of conflict, there is a pressing need to rebuild roads, bridges, buildings, and other essential structures. By incorporating IoT sensors into construction materials and equipment, builders can monitor the structural integrity of these assets in real time, making maintenance and repairs more cost-effective and timely. In the agriculture sector, IoT technology can help farmers increase their yields and optimize resource usage. By deploying sensors to monitor soil moisture levels, temperature, and other crucial factors, farmers can make informed decisions about irrigation, fertilization, and pest control. This data-driven approach can lead to higher crop yields, lower production costs, and a more sustainable agricultural sector. IoT can also play a vital role in the energy sector by enabling the integration of renewable energy sources such as solar and wind power. By deploying smart meters and sensors to monitor energy consumption patterns and production levels, policymakers can better manage the supply and demand of electricity, reduce waste, and promote the shift towards clean energy sources. In addition to these sectors, IoT can also be utilized in healthcare, transportation, manufacturing, and other industries to drive innovation and promote economic growth. By embracing IoT technology as a key enabler of development, Syria can position itself at the forefront of the digital revolution and build a more resilient and prosperous economy for the future. In conclusion, rebuilding Syria's economy after dictatorship is a complex and challenging task that requires a multi-faceted approach. By harnessing the power of Internet of Things technology, Syria can unlock new opportunities for growth, sustainability, and prosperity. It is essential for policymakers, businesses, and civil society to collaborate and invest in IoT infrastructure to pave the way for a brighter future for the Syrian people.
